Ingredients for Your Perfect Roast
- One (4-5 pound) bone-in pork shoulder roast: Look for a roast with good marbling for maximum tenderness.
- 1 tablespoon olive oil: For searing and adding depth of flavor.
- 1 teaspoon salt: To enhance the natural flavors of the pork.
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per: A classic pairing for pork.
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der: Adds a savory, pungent aroma.
- 1/2 teaspoon onion powder: Complements the garlic powder beautifully.
- 1 cup chicken broth: To keep the roast moist during cooking.
- 1 cup your favorite BBQ sauce: Use your go-to BBQ sauce for a personalized flavor profile.
Step-by-Step Cooking Instructions
Preparation:
- Preheat your oven to 325°F (160°C). This ensures even cooking throughout the roast.
- Pat the pork shoulder dry with paper towels. This helps achieve a good sear.
- Season generously with salt, pepper, garlic powder, and onion powder. Make sure all sides are evenly coated.
- Sear the pork shoulder in a large oven-safe skillet or Dutch oven over medium-high heat with olive oil until nicely browned on all sides. This step adds a delicious crust and enhances the flavor.
Cooking:
- Pour the chicken broth into the bottom of the skillet.
- Transfer the skillet to the preheated oven.
- Roast for approximately 3-4 hours, or until the internal temperature reaches 190-195°F (88-91°C) when measured with a meat thermometer. The cooking time will vary depending on the size of your roast.
- Baste the pork shoulder with the pan juices every hour for added moisture and flavor.
- Once the internal temperature is reached, remove the pork shoulder from the oven. Let it rest for at least 15-20 minutes before shredding. This allows the juices to redistribute, resulting in a more tender and flavorful roast.
Shredding and Serving:
- Shred the pork shoulder using two forks.
- Mix in your favorite BBQ sauce. The longer you let the pork sit, the easier it will be to shred.
- Serve immediately on buns, with coleslaw, or as a standalone dish.
Tips for the Best Bone-in Pork Shoulder Roast
- Use a meat thermometer: This is crucial for ensuring the pork is cooked to a safe internal temperature.
- Don't overcrowd the pan: Allow for proper air circulation around the roast for even cooking.
- Let the roast rest: This crucial step allows the juices to redistribute, resulting in a more tender and juicy roast.
- Get creative with your BBQ sauce: Experiment with different flavors to find your perfect match.
